Langes Umschalten bei neuem Monitor vermeiden?

RedXon

Lt. Commander
Registriert
März 2010
Beiträge
1.159
Hallo zusammen

Entschuldigt bitte den etwas kryptischen Titel, mir fehlte es aber leider an einer genaueren Beschreibung des Problems in kürze.

Der Punkt ist: Mein PC hat 4 Monitore die dauerhaft angeschlossen sind, soweit so gut, keine Probleme hier. Zusätzlich ist aber mein TV angeschlossen per HDMI, der natürlich nicht immer läuft wenn der PC läuft. Wenn der TV ausgeschaltet ist, wird er nicht erkannt und ist nicht aufgeführt in den Optionen. Sobald ich ihn aber einschalte, egal ob auf der Quelle des PCs oder auf TV oder Xbox oder was auch immer, muss der PC aus irgend einem Grund alle Bildschirme wie neu initialisieren.

Das heisst: Windows neue Hardware Jingle, gefolgt von alle Bildschirme werden schwarz. Bildschirm 1 geht kurz an, dann wieder ab, dasselbe bei Bildschirm 2 usw... bis irgendwann alle wieder da sind, inklusive TV (egal ob auf der richtigen Quelle oder nicht). Das ganze Prozedere geht doch schon 10 Sekunden oder mehr.
Ich finde das etwas nervig und frage mich, muss ich das einfach akzeptieren oder gibt es eine Einstellung oder ein Tool um dies zu vermeiden? Ich verstehe nicht ganz, wieso Windows alle anderen Bildschirme neu laden muss, da diese ja auch von Ausrichtung, Position, Auflösung und Refreshrate genau gleich bleiben?

Danke fürs lesen und für jede potentielle Hilfe ;)
 
hmm... kann ich nur zu sagen: macht es bei mir auch (2 Monitore+TV), sobald ich den TV mit dranhänge werden die beiden Monitore kurz dunkel+Windows macht eben tüdeldü.

edit: hab jetzt im Service Menü des Bildschirms (Power on+Menu bei Benq) HotPlug Detection deaktiviert, hat bei mir nichts geändert...

edit2: bei AMD lässt sich da wohl was in der Registry drehen, bei nvidia funkt das nur bei Quadro Karten...

Currently there are these known workarounds:

AMD: Disabling the automatic monitor detection by setting the "DMMEnableDDCPolling" DWORD to zero. (https://answers.microsoft.com/en-us...r/e0b8bb93-5960-4273-b959-4e3177946f8d?page=3)
While this is not a 100% satisfactory solution (as it will require the user to do manual detection when hardware is changed), it at least disables that annoying hot-plug along with it's unwanted side effects. There have also been reports that starting with the AMD Catalyst Driver 13.6 Beta, the problem has since been resolved.
NVIDIA: Displayport blanking by exporting and overriding the EDID information for each monitor (as showcased here: https://sites.google.com/site/ebobster/stuff/displayportblanking). Unfortunately, while this would keep the monitors in the desired state, it is exclusively available to the Quadro (and possibly Tesla) series.

https://www.reddit.com/r/nvidia/comments/66opvp/this_displayport_hotplug_madness_finally_needs_to/
 
Zuletzt bearbeitet:
Eventuell im Grafiktreiber, den Monitor deaktivieren und nur bei Gebrauch aktivieren. z.B. über zwei verschiedene Profile. Kann aber nicht verifizieren ob das zum Ziel führt.
 
Ich glaub es ist immer noch so, dass aus allen Monitoren nur "ein einziger großer Monitor" gemacht wird. Wenn du also "Links" einen Bildschirm aktivierst, müssen alle Bildschirmpositionen neu berechnet werden.
Ich würde probieren was passiert, wenn du den TV ganz "Rechts" konfigurierst.

Gerade an einem Win8.1 PC aber es müsste ähnlich aussehen:
4 Monitore.PNG
 
Theobald93 schrieb:
Ich glaub es ist immer noch so, dass aus allen Monitoren nur "ein einziger großer Monitor" gemacht wird.

Nee, das ist ja reine Einstellungssache. Ich hab z.B. die beiden Bildschirme erweitert, der rechte davon ist der primäre und wird mit dem TV geklont.
Dass wirklich transparent für die Anwendungen ein Virtueller Bildschirm mit der gesamten Auflösung erstellt wird ist nur bei AMD "Eyefinity" oder Nvidia "Surround Spanning" der Fall.
 
Interessant. Das mit dem einzigen grossen Monitor kann so natürlich nicht stimmen, da man ja in Anwendungen und so die Monitore einzeln wählen kann. Aber es ist gut möglich, dass der PC die Positionen alle neu berechnen muss. Ich hab schon eher länger keine grosse Linux erfahrung mehr, aber wenns mir recht ist war dies hier nicht so, oder?

Interessant wäre es aber wirklich, eine Option um den Monitor manuell aktivieren zu können, was mit Boardmitteln momentan leider nicht so ganz klappt. Denn selbst wenn er im NVidia Control Panel deaktiviert ist passiert das selbe wenn eingeschaltet, er aktiviert sich dann einfach nicht. Ich glaube ich hab irgendwo noch 'nen Display Fusion Key herum liegen oder so, mal schauen was das macht.

Zudem @Theobald93 der TV ist ganz rechts, sieht dann so aus:
Capture.PNG


Zur Erklärung was ich machen will:
Neben dem sehr seltenen Fall, dass ich ein Video direkt vom PC auf dem TV abspielen will (dafür hab ich eigentlich meinen Shield) geht es hauptsächlich um Spiele, meist in Steam Bic Picture. Das heisst Steam ist so eingestellt (was wirklich eine praktische Funktion ist) dass Big Picture immer auf dem TV auf geht und der TV der primäre Monitor wird. So weit so gut. Wenn ich dies will stört mich das flackern und das refreshen auch nicht, da ich dann ja eh an den TV wechsle.

Problematisch wird es wenn der TV für etwas anderes gebraucht wird. Wenn ich am arbeiten bin oder so und der TV sich ein oder aus schaltet ist das ja auch nicht weiter tragisch, aber gestern war ich beispielsweise online am Spielen, als der TV sich ausschaltete. Ist dann relativ mühsam wenn man im Spiel ca. 10 Sekunden keine Kontrolle mehr hat weil die Bildschirme sich neu was-auch-immern. Spannenderweise hat das Spiel dies überlebt und es gab keinen Crash...
 
Zurück
Oben